    As I'm a fan of Minecraft and Survivalcraft, can someone explain why this game is so good? It seems to me that the lack of 3D could remove the sense of exploration seen in those games.

    I can't properly explain it. Yes, it is very similar to the *craft games in 2D.

    I see it similar to Terraria as well, which my friend picked up and said to me "why shouldn't I just play minecraft?"

    Though that was in relation to the 360 version of minecraft.

    On iOS, there is no question that this game is awsome and is a welcome addition, especially at the price. It provides awesome things like treasures, statutes and such that give the exploration some real "depth".

    Personally, I keep going back to JJ to quell my desire for minecraft. It's much easier to control and it is incredibly fun to play.

    Watch some gameplay videos to see if you're feeling it, but for me this is an amazing game well, well, WELL worth the $3

    It's very different from the 3D block builders. The joy of Junk Jack is in collecting the junk -- neat and cool pixel loot and goodies hidden in chests, popping out of blocks, falling out of slain monsters. :D And decorating your 2D structures with them.

    If you actually find the controls on the touchscreen for Survivalcraft, et al, immersive, then I can see where you wouldn't find this a superior experience.

    However, I find myself futzing with interface more than anything with the 3D craft games, this just isn't the platform for it (for me at any rate). Junk Jack removes all the awkwardness of 3D controls on a phone sized device, and gives me an absolutely charming time killer. Been playing on and off since launch and can't wait for JJX.
